Transaction 5646a62b247b15e28c7d6385c155aeafcfbab9b660b7b967ec6c7f28fa9a784e
1 Input
1 Output
-
5646a62b247b15e28c7d6385c155aeafcfbab9b660b7b967ec6c7f28fa9a784e:0
- value
- 23390586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d65aec57533f44778bda14267c1ec84874cb18d8 OP_EQUAL
- address
- 3MERT3tiH4e1i3VLrmAFvtgfVy9kuXcfLs